Our verdict is Pathogenic. The variant received 12 ACMG points: 12P and 0B. PVS1PM2PP5_Moderate

The NM_000098.3(CPT2):​c.1360G>T​(p.Glu454*) variant causes a stop gained change involving the alteration of a conserved nucleotide. The variant was absent in control chromosomes in GnomAD project.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Pathogenic (★). Synonymous variant affecting the same amino acid position (i.e. E454E) has been classified as Likely benign. Variant results in nonsense mediated mRNA decay.

Genes affected
CPT2 (HGNC:2330): (carnitine palmitoyltransferase 2) The protein encoded by this gene is a nuclear protein which is transported to the mitochondrial inner membrane. Together with carnitine palmitoyltransferase I, the encoded protein oxidizes long-chain fatty acids in the mitochondria. Defects in this gene are associated with mitochondrial long-chain fatty-acid (LCFA) oxidation disorders.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]

This sequence change creates a premature translational stop signal (p.Glu454*) in the CPT2 gene. It is expected to result in an absent or disrupted protein product. Loss-of-function variants in CPT2 are known to be pathogenic (PMID: 16781677, 16996287). This variant is not present in population databases (ExAC no frequency). This premature translational stop signal has been observed in individual(s) with clinical features of carnitine palmitoyltransferase II deficiency (PMID: 15622536). 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 8966). For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. -
